Farmland Partners Announces Transformative, Accretive Merger With American Farmland Company
September 12, 2016 6:31 AM EDTDENVER, and NEW YORK, Sept. 12, 2016 /PRNewswire/ --Â Farmland Partners Inc. (NYSE: FPI) ("FPI") and American Farmland Company (NYSE MKT: AFCO) ("AFCO") jointly announced today that they have entered into a definitive agreement (the "Agreement") pursuant to which FPI has agreed to acquire all of the outstanding common stock of AFCO in a stock-for-stock transaction.
